Deciding whether to ask your ex-fiancé out after a period of no contact requires careful consideration and self-reflection. Before making any moves, here are some essential steps to think about:
Assess Your Feelings: Take time to understand your emotions and motivations. Are you genuinely interested in getting back together because you still love and care for him, or are you feeling lonely or seeking familiarity? Ensure your intentions are sincere and not solely driven by the fear of being alone.
Evaluate Past Issues: Reflect on the reasons why your relationship ended in the first place. Consider whether those issues have been resolved or if there is a genuine possibility for growth and improvement in the relationship.
Communication: Before asking him out, ensure that you both have had open and honest communication about your feelings and what you hope to achieve by reconnecting. It's essential to be on the same page regarding your expectations.
Mutual Interest: Consider if there are signs that he may also be interested in reconciling. Look for any indications that he might be open to getting back together.
Respect His Boundaries: If he has expressed that he needs more time or is not interested in rekindling the relationship, respect his decision. Pushing him into something he's not ready for may not lead to a healthy relationship.
Learn from the Past: Reflect on what went wrong in the previous relationship and consider what you both can do differently to create a healthier and more fulfilling partnership.
Seek Outside Support: If you're unsure about your decision, consider talking to a trusted friend, family member, or even a therapist to gain additional perspectives and support.
Remember that relationships are complex, and getting back together after a breakup can be challenging. It's crucial to proceed with caution and maturity. If you decide to ask him out, approach the situation with sincerity and a willingness to listen to his thoughts and feelings.
Alternatively, instead of jumping into asking him out immediately, you might start by suggesting a casual meeting to catch up and talk. Use this opportunity to gauge his receptiveness to reconnecting and whether there is still potential for a future together.
Ultimately, only you can determine if getting back together is the right decision for both of you. Trust your instincts, but be thoughtful and mindful of the potential consequences. Whatever the outcome, prioritize your well-being and emotional health throughout the process.
